I have seen so many women ask this, and the answer is always no. Day 1 symptoms are biologically impossible because hormones only rise after implantation, which takes over a week. Keep busy and test after a missed period.

Oh my god, I used to analyze every single pinch and cramp right after trying, thinking it was the day I conceived! But honestly, implantation takes about 6 to 12 days, so you won't feel anything on day one itself. Try to distract yourself and stay calm.
